WPL 2025 Points Table: Delhi Capitals Lead as League Phase Hits Midway

Published on

KKN Gurugram Desk | The Women’s Premier League (WPL) 2025 is in full swing, and the league phase has reached its halfway point. A total of 20 matches are scheduled in this phase, and 10 of them have already been played. As of February 25, the match between Delhi Capitals and Gujarat Giants, which was the 10th of the season, concluded with a dominant victory for Delhi. This has given us a clearer picture of the current standings in the WPL 2025 points table.

Delhi Capitals: Dominating the League

At the top of the points table, Delhi Capitals are leading the pack with 6 points from 5 matches. The team has managed to win 3 out of the 5 games played so far. Royal Challengers Bangalore: Close Behind Delhi

Following Delhi Capitals,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) sits in second place. They have played 4 matches so far, winning 2 and securing 4 points. Despite a couple of losses, RCB remains in a strong position due to their decent net run rate, which is better than Mumbai Indians, who also have 4 points. Mumbai Indians: Strong Contenders but Need to Step Up

Mumbai Indians (MI) occupy the third spot on the points table with 4 points from 3 matches, having won 2 out of the 3 games played. While their record is similar to that of RCB, MI’s net run rate is slightly inferior. This is the reason they are placed below RCB. UP Warriorz: Close Behind the Top Teams

UP Warriorz also have 4 points after playing 4 matches, winning 2 and losing 2. Despite having the same points as RCB and MI, their net run rate is lower, placing them in the fourth spot on the points table. Gujarat Giants: Struggling at the Bottom

At the bottom of the points table, Gujarat Giants are struggling with only 2 points from 4 matches. They have managed to win just 1 game, and their net run rate is currently in the negative.
